    Heavyweight Bobby Lashley and UFC veteran Phil Baroni returned to the win column with victories at Friday’s Titan Fighting Championships 17 in Kansas City, Kansas.

    Both Lashley and Baroni were visibly tired after their opening rounds, but Lashley pushed to a unanimous decision over undersized late-replacement John Ott, while Baroni escaped with a unanimous decision over Nick Nolte.

    The HDNet-televised event also included wins by Aaron Rosa, Eric Marriott, Alonzo Martinez, and James Krause.
